Qualification for a Seller lead

For a seller lead, qualification should preserve the person’s stated context, create an auditable record and stop before unsupported automation. It does not prove that a production CRM, calendar, messaging or property-data connection is active.

Direct answer

Capture property address, ownership role, motivation, timeline and requested valuation help only as relevant to this stage. Store intent, timeline, stated budget, constraints, missing fields and confidence. Use that evidence to decide which questions are relevant and whether human review is needed, then hand off to the listing or valuation team when the stop conditions require it.

Four-step implementation

  1. Collect only the stated property address, ownership role, motivation, timeline and requested valuation help.
  2. Create the stage record: intent, timeline, stated budget, constraints, missing fields and confidence.
  3. Use the record to decide which questions are relevant and whether human review is needed.
  4. Stop when protected-class inference, lending decision, legal advice or insufficient evidence; pass context to the listing or valuation team when required.

Stop and escalate

Stop automation for protected-class inference, lending decision, legal advice or insufficient evidence. Do not use this flow for invented valuations, guaranteed sale timing or pressure tactics.

Evidence boundary

Qualification organizes stated needs; it must not become discriminatory screening, credit approval or a prediction of transaction success. This guide describes a workflow specification, not a deployed integration, legal conclusion, fair-housing approval, response-time promise, conversion forecast or transaction result.
